| event_narrative | The Marks-Nielson Fire began in the early morning hours of the 11th of January and continued to burn until February 14th. The fire was spread through 3 acres of woodchips and other debris piled over 20-feet high in spots. It began by spontaneous combustion and caused a health problem due to its soot for much of the Fresno metropolitan area. With a number of agencies involved along with the Federal EPA intervention, the cost of putting the fire out is estimated to be over $2.5M. |
